New Zealand vs Bangladesh - 1st ODI


The first ODI of the 3 match ODI series between New Zealand and Bangladesh held today at McLean Park, Napier. It was a Day Night match.
New Zealand won the toss and decided to bat first.

New Zealand's Squad:
B McCullum, P Ingram, M Guptill, R Taylor, J Franklin, N Broom, D Vettori, J Oram, T Southee, D Tuffey and A McKay.

Bangladesh Squad:
Tamim Iqbal, Imrul Kayes, Mohammad Ashraful, Raqibul Hasan, Shakib Al Hasan, Mushfiqur Rahim, Mahmudullah, Naeem Islam, Shahadat Hossin, Shafiul Islam and Nazmul Hossain.

Match Result:
New Zealand won the match by 146 runs and leading the series as 1-0. J Oram was named as the player of the match for his 83 runs and 2 wickets.

Match Summary:
New Zealand came well with their bat and scored 336 runs in 50 overs by losing 9 wickets. For New Zealand J Oram scored 83 runs off just 40 balls which includes 8-4's & 5-6's. N Broom added 71 runs off 73 balls with 7-4's. P Ingram scored 69 runs off 74 balls with 9-4's, R Taylor 51 runs off 52 ball with 4-4's & 2-6's. For Bangladesh Shafiul Islam picked 4 wickets and Shahdat Hossain, Shakib Al Hasan & Naeem Islam each picked 1 wicket.

With the target of 337 runs, Tamim Iqbal and Imrul Kayes opened Bangladesh's innings. But Bangladesh batsmen were not able to complete their full 50 overs and lost all their wickets at 43.5 overs by adding 190 runs. For Bangladeh Tamim Iqbal scored 62 off 69 balls with 10-4's, Imrul Kayes 33 runs off 29 balls with 4-4's & 2-6's and Mahmudullah 23 runs off 23 balls with 1-4 & 1-6. For New Zealand D Vettori picked 3 wickets, A McKay, J Oram & M Guptill each picked 2 wickets and D Tuffey 1 wicket.
